Created by a Chinese development team, DeepSeek R1 is a scalable AI model designed to cater to a wide range of applications, from lightweight tasks to enterprise-level operations.

Its hardware requirements vary significantly depending on the size of the model you intend to deploy. Ranging from compact 1.5 billion-parameter versions to the massive 671 billion-parameter model, understanding these requirements is critical for achieving both optimal performance and resource efficiency. This overview provides a detailed breakdown of the hardware needs for different model sizes, helping you make informed decisions tailored to your specific use case.

DeepSeek R1 Hardware Requirements

TL;DR Key Takeaways :

  • DeepSeek R1 offers scalable AI models, with hardware requirements varying significantly based on model size, from 1.5B to 671B parameters.
  • Smaller models (1.5B) are highly accessible, requiring only a CPU, 8 GB of RAM, and no dedicated GPU, while slightly larger models (7B-8B) benefit from GPUs with at least 8 GB of VRAM for faster performance.
  • Mid-range models (14B-32B) require GPUs with 12-24 GB of VRAM for optimal performance, balancing resource needs and computational efficiency.
  • Larger models (70B-671B) demand high-end hardware, including GPUs with 48 GB VRAM or multi-GPU setups (e.g., 20 Nvidia RTX 3090s or 10 Nvidia RTX A6000s) for enterprise-level applications.

Smaller Models: Accessible and Lightweight

The 1.5 billion-parameter version of DeepSeek R1 is designed to be highly accessible, with minimal hardware demands. This makes it an excellent choice for users with standard computing setups. To run this model effectively, you’ll need:

  • A CPU no older than 10 years
  • At least 8 GB of RAM
  • No dedicated GPU or VRAM required

This configuration is ideal for users who prioritize simplicity and cost-efficiency over processing speed. However, if you plan to work with slightly larger models, such as the 7B or 8B versions, the requirements increase modestly. While these models can still operate on a CPU-only system, performance may be slower. To enhance speed and efficiency, consider incorporating a GPU with at least 8 GB of VRAM. This allows the model to use parallel processing, significantly improving computation times.

Mid-Range Models: Striking a Balance

For mid-range models like the 14B and 32B versions, the hardware requirements become more substantial, reflecting their increased computational complexity. These models strike a balance between performance and resource demands, making them suitable for users with moderately advanced hardware setups.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 14B Model: A GPU with a minimum of 12 GB of VRAM is required, though 16 GB is recommended for smoother operation and to accommodate additional processes.
  • 32B Model: At least 24 GB of VRAM is necessary for optimal GPU-based performance. Systems with less VRAM can still run the model, but the workload will be distributed across the GPU, CPU, and RAM, leading to slower processing speeds.

These mid-range models are ideal for users who need a balance between computational power and resource availability. However, they require more robust hardware compared to smaller models, particularly if you aim to maintain efficient processing times.

Key Factors for Efficient AI Deployment

Selecting the right hardware for DeepSeek R1 involves aligning the model size with your available resources and future goals. Here are some key considerations to keep in mind:

  • Smaller Models: These require only standard hardware, making them accessible to most users with basic setups.
  • Mid-Range Models: These benefit significantly from GPUs with moderate VRAM capacities, improving performance and reducing processing times.
  • Larger Models: These demand high-end GPUs or multi-GPU configurations, along with robust power and cooling systems to ensure smooth operation.
  • Scalability: If you anticipate upgrading to larger models in the future, ensure that your hardware setup is scalable and can accommodate increased demands.

For multi-GPU configurations, it’s essential to verify compatibility between GPUs and ensure that your system can handle the increased computational load. Additionally, consider the long-term costs associated with power consumption and cooling when planning your hardware investment.
